#ebcce6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ebcce6 is composed of 92.2% red, 80%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 309.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 86.1%. #ebcce6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d799cd.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#ebcce6 color description : Light grayish magenta.
#ebcce6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ebcce6 has RGB values of R:235, G:204,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.02,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15453414.
